1. Understand the Exam Before You Begin
It is important that before you begin preparing for the exam, you know exactly how it will take place. The 2026 IELTS exam tests your proficiency in listening, reading, writing, and speaking, and each skill comes with its unique format and duration. However, many students disregard this fact and immediately start practicing without really knowing anything about the test itself, only to find themselves confused. When you have an understanding of how the exam will go, you can better prepare yourself for it.

2. Discipline in Practice, Not Only in Hard Work
The main blunder that students tend to do while preparing is practicing without proper discipline and timing. In order to ace the IELTS test in 2026, you should develop a regular routine that includes practice for all four parts. Timing yourself when practicing allows you to become more effective in terms of speed and quality. It will also help you deal with the test atmosphere during the real test. Thus, disciplined practice, rather than random one, will contribute to your better performance.
3. Don’t Make Your English Too Complicated
Most candidates think that by using complex vocabulary and complicated sentences, they can easily get high scores. But in IELTS test conducted in 2026, simplicity will be preferred over complexity. If you use too complicated sentences in your writing or speaking, then chances of errors will become higher. So you should try to write and speak in simple and easy English which clearly expresses what you want to convey. Natural way of speaking and writing always makes good impact compared to memorized expressions.
4. Be Structured While Writing
This section is where most of the students lose marks since the points are disorganized. For the upcoming IELTS exam in the year 2026, it is essential to write an essay that follows a proper structure. This means that your essay will be expected to include a proper introduction, body paragraphs, and a good conclusion. By doing so, you can ensure that the examiner finds it easy to follow your ideas. Not only this, but your marks can improve dramatically through practice.
5. Boost Your Self-Confidence for Oral Exam
It is a natural tendency that nervousness affects your performance in the speaking test, but self-confidence plays a critical role in turning things around in your favor. In the 2026 IELTS test, the examiner will care about your communication skills rather than flawless English grammar. It is all about communicating clearly without having to worry too much about speaking like a native English speaker. With regular practice on a daily basis, you can easily overcome the fear of speaking English.

How much time do I need to prepare for the IELTS exam in 2026?
Preparation time for the IELTS exam in 2026 is dependent on the level of knowledge of the English language. Normally, 4 to 8 weeks of proper preparation are sufficient for achieving success in the IELTS test.
What is considered a good score in the IELTS exam in 2026?
A good score in the IELTS exam in 2026 means scoring 6.5 to 7 bands in the examination. It must be noted that top universities/immigration programs need minimum 7.5 to 8 bands.
